Location: City of London

We are recruiting a Coordinator to support in attracting and hiring talented people across a wide range of office, construction site and factory-based positions. Supporting the full recruitment lifecycle, you'll be involved in everything from supporting the sourcing of candidates to arranging interviews, monitoring compliance and security checks and helping to create a positive and welcoming onboarding experience.

This role is ideal for someone who enjoys connecting with people, providing an exceptional recruitment experience, and contributing to the continued growth and success of the business.

The role is office based in London Bridge.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Deliver a positive and engaging candidate experience by managing communications and providing timely updates throughout the recruitment journey
  • Monitor and manage job advertisements across a variety of online recruitment platforms, ensuring vacancies are accurate, engaging and effectively promoted.
  • Coordinate interviews ensuring all activity is organised in a timely fashion
  • Support the onboarding and pre-boarding process, helping new starters feel informed, welcomed and prepared for their first day
  • Maintain accurate candidate records and recruitment activity using the applicant tracking system
  • Create and advertise engaging job adverts across relevant channels to attract high-quality and diverse talent
  • Supporting recruitment events, careers fairs and employer branding initiatives

Skills and Experience

  • The ability to support multiple vacancies and priorities with excellent attention to detail
  • Strong organisational and communication skills, with a customer-focused approach
  • Proactive and adaptable, with a positive attitude and a desire to continuously learn
  • Administration skills/good knowledge of MS Office tools
  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to build relationships with people at all levels.
  • A professional telephone manner
  • Previous experience or internships in similar HR or recruitment roles are a plus.
